    Quote Originally Posted by Head-On View Post
    Isuzu coming up with 1.9 blue diesel engine.

    What now can others say about turboed small displacement diesel engines being more stressed which may lead to shorter engine life?

    Will the vaunted B10 rating of isuzu engines still hold true for the 1.9 blue?
    Isuzu conducted an 5,755 KM endurance run of the newly launched 1.9 DDi on three D-Max trucks over a year ago from Thailand to Laos then China. So far wala pa naman ako nababasang failures sa RZ4E save for the noticeable engine clatter.
